I need a letter of employment for my mortgage companue I have work partime all my life and now am Full time I am only 18 so this is my first full time job.With an FHA Loan, Can the Seller Pay the Buyer's Closing. – Seller contributions can be applied toward the buyer’s closing costs, but they cannot be used for the borrower’s minimum required investment (or down payment). Payment of real estate agent commissions or fees, which are typically paid by the seller, is not considered to be an interested party contribution.

Underwriter Letter Of Explanation Sample · Written By: Frankie Lacy. Letters of Explanation (sometimes abbreviated to LOX or LOE) are a common condition on loan files. Underwriters request them to explain large deposits, residence histories, derogatory credit, credit inquiries, and much more.

Award Emblem: Top 5 Subprime Mortgage Lenders. There are options to obtain mortgages for bad credit from bad credit mortgage lenders. Called subprime mortgages, these poor credit home loans are designed to offer homeownership opportunities to consumers whose credit score may not meet the minimum standard of a traditional lender or who might have a higher debt-to-income ratio.
